fre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

最新燕山大學(xué)圖像處理課程設(shè)計(jì)基本文本圖像的傾斜校正(編輯修改稿)

2025-07-21 00:35 本頁(yè)面
 

【文章內(nèi)容簡(jiǎn)介】 [I,J] = find(R=max(max(R)))。 %J記錄了傾斜角qingxiejiao=90J。bw=imrotate(bw,qingxiejiao,39。bilinear39。,39。crop39。)。 %qingxiejiao取值為正則逆時(shí)針旋轉(zhuǎn)figure,imshow(bw)。title(39。傾斜校正后圖像39。)。 %輸出校正圖像 3)基于投影實(shí)現(xiàn)特殊方向文本—垂直和倒立文本的校正。1. 適用范圍:僅適用于正負(fù)90度或180度傾斜的表格、文本,文字等排列比較整齊圖片,打印、手寫(xiě)均可。2. 將圖像轉(zhuǎn)化為灰度圖像。3. 向水平和垂直方向投影,找出投影大于一定閾值(經(jīng)實(shí)驗(yàn)后取450)的方向即為行所在方向,進(jìn)而識(shí)別傾斜角是90度還是180度。4. imrotate函數(shù)傾斜校正。每一個(gè)處理后同時(shí)輸出兩張旋轉(zhuǎn)角相差180度的圖片,解決可能出現(xiàn)的90文字倒立的問(wèn)題(原創(chuàng),前所未有)。5. 代碼部分:i=imread(39。D:\39。)。imshow(i)。title(39。原圖像39。)。bw=rgb2gray(i)。bw=im2bw(i,graythresh(bw)) %自動(dòng)二值化[mt1,nt1] = size(bw)。Ty=find(sum(bw)=450==1)。 %向橫軸投影,投影點(diǎn)的灰度值累加,閾值取450,大于450的區(qū)域即為累加后的白色投影的位置%b =length(Ty)rat= length(Ty) / nt1。 if (rat= ) % A=imrotate(i,270)。 %圖像校正 C=imrotate(i,90)。 %圖像校正 subplot(1,2,1)。imshow(A)。title(39。校正圖像139。)。 subplot(1,2,2)。imshow(C)。title(39。校正圖像239。)。 else %比例= A=imrotate(i,0)。 %圖像校正 C=imrotate(i,180)。 %圖像校正 subplot(1,2,1)。imshow(A)。title(39。校正圖像139。)。 subplot(1,2,2)。imshow(C)。title(39。校正圖像239。)。end4)基于傅立葉頻域分析的文本、表格、圖像的傾斜校正。適用范圍:可用于表格、矩形及一些文字校正,文字手寫(xiě)打印均可,文本行最好有下劃線識(shí)別率更高。1. 離散傅里葉變換fft2處理成頻域圖片。2. 交換高低頻位置fftshift。3. 將頻域圖片按所在象限分割,分別計(jì)算各象限中線的斜率,求四個(gè)傾斜角平均值。4. 通過(guò)原圖矩陣乘以一個(gè)傾斜校正的矩陣實(shí)現(xiàn)圖片旋轉(zhuǎn),達(dá)到傾斜校正目的。 5. 代碼部分clcclearf = imread(39。D:\39。)。f = im2double(f)。 %把圖像數(shù)據(jù)類(lèi)型轉(zhuǎn)換為雙精度浮點(diǎn)類(lèi)型。figure(1), imshow(f, [])title(39。39。)F = fft2(f)。 %fft2是2維離散傅立葉變換%imshow(F)Fc = fftshift(F)。 %低頻移到頻域圖的中間%imshow(Fc)S = log(1 + abs(Fc))。 %輸入圖像的頻域圖%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%↓%下面將頻域圖按所在象限分成四塊,分別計(jì)算每個(gè)象限亮線的傾斜角[m, n] = size(Fc)。M = floor(m/2)+1。 N = floor(n/2)+1。 %取原頻域圖的幾何中心點(diǎn)。floor為向下取整S1 = S(M150:M, N:N+150)。 %分別將頻域圖按所在象限等分成四塊[M, N] = size(S1)。 %取出第一象限S1(M5:M, 1:5) = 0。 S5 = S1。 %標(biāo)出原頻域圖的幾何中心點(diǎn),方便查看for k = 1:20 maximum = max(max(S1))。 %maximum取最大值 [I1(k), J1(k)] = find(S1 == maximum)。 %最大值的位置坐標(biāo) S1(I1(k),J1(k)) = 0。 %最大值點(diǎn)變?yōu)樵c(diǎn)
點(diǎn)擊復(fù)制文檔內(nèi)容
物理相關(guān)推薦
文庫(kù)吧 www.dybbs8.com
備案圖片鄂ICP備17016276號(hào)-1